Overview Of Function

Knowledge Management (KM) is one of four key pillars to the Solutions Team at L.E.K. Consulting, alongside Data & Analytics, Market Insights, and Information & Research Center. The Solutions team works together to support and enable our consulting team members to generate best‑in‑class insights for our clients. Knowledge Management is critical to capturing the best of our consulting staff’s individual and collective expertise to make it available to the broader firm.

KM is focused on developing and distributing insights, frameworks, and tools for our consulting team members to leverage on casework and business development, enabling consulting teams to utilize best‑in‑class insights, approaches, and be more efficient in their work.

The Knowledge Management Manager leads the US KM function to ensure knowledge assets are embedded in core business processes. Reporting to the Solutions Director, this individual oversees U.S. KM operations, drives innovation in knowledge services, and leads a high‑performing team of KM professionals across sectors and service lines.

Responsibilities
Knowledge Management Strategy
  • Collaborate with the Senior Director, Solutions to develop KM’s role in the Solutions portfolio and, alongside EU and APAC leads, drive the firm’s global KM strategy, covering IP development, dissemination, and quality standards across sectors and service lines.
  • Ensure knowledge assets are embedded in business processes and accessible to consulting teams for proposal development, case delivery, and business development.
  • Coordinate with regional KM leaders and Strategy & Operations teams to set priorities and maintain global consistency.
  • Drive the firm’s knowledge agenda by identifying capability gaps, setting quality benchmarks, and championing best practices.
Team Management and Engagement
  • Provide oversight of the US KM team and US‑aligned, India‑based Content team.
  • Support KM team members in developing expertise, building strong relationships, and amplifying impact.
  • Meet regularly with KM sector and service line teams to support progress on initiatives and address sector and stakeholder needs.
  • Drive the team to own and continuously improve the breadth, depth, and quality of recommendations and support.
  • Oversee onboarding of new team members and support professional development and career progression.
  • Foster a strong sense of KM team community and shared purpose across the function.
Innovation and Continuous Improvement
  • Drive the innovation and evolution of KM offerings and best practices, including:
    • Increased automation of core processes.
    • Harnessing AI tools to surface new knowledge and insights at scale.
    • Identification and piloting of new services.
    • Unifying knowledge silos and repositories into a more streamlined interface.
    • Continued evolution of team structure and operating model.
    • Supporting further technology initiatives, including enhanced platform functionality.
  • Drive visibility and uptake of knowledge tools.
Stakeholder and Cross‑Functional Collaboration
  • Promote and elevate the KM value proposition to senior stakeholders across the firm.
  • Collaborate with other Solutions leads (primary and secondary research) to integrate functions and functional knowledge for a more cohesive stakeholder experience.
